>  *We have an issue with images (**TIFF files) that are loaded into a
> postgres database table (where the image field is defined as type **“**lo*
> *”**)**. The code to load the images is written in VB and the connection
> to the database is through postgres odbc** installed on the PC. * *All
> images inserted through the VB program are retrievable also through
> odbc/VB, as long as the table **rows **at the backend **are** not 
> re**organized
> in any way. If the table dat**a** is unloaded/reloaded or clustered (on
> an index) or rel**oaded through a pg_dump and restore, then **on trying
> to retrieve the images, **the VB program gets the error : **“**Multiple-step
> OLE DB operation generat**ed errors. Check each OLE DB status value**……*
> *etc**”**.*
>
> *The data in the backend database is still readable through other image
> retrieval progr**ams connecting directly to the server (not through ODBC
> or VB).*
>

Are you reloading into the very same database, or into a different one?
Your question doesn't make it clear. If you're loading into a new database,
then one thing that comes to mind is that the bytea_output parameter in
postgresql.conf might be different on the second database.
